U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
UE::Net::FStaticActorNetCreationHeader Class Reference

#include <NetActorFactory.h>

+ Inheritance diagram for UE::Net::FStaticActorNetCreationHeader:

Public Member Functions

virtual bool IsDynamic () const
 
virtual bool IsPreregistered () const
 
virtual ENGINE_API bool Serialize (const FCreationHeaderContext &Context) const override
 
virtual ENGINE_API bool Deserialize (const FCreationHeaderContext &Context) override
 
virtual ENGINE_API FString ToString () const override
 
- Public Member Functions inherited from UE::Net::FBaseActorNetCreationHeader
ENGINE_API EActorNetSpawnInfoFlags GetFactorySpawnFlags (const UNetActorFactory *ActorFactory) const
 
- Public Member Functions inherited from UE::Net::FNetObjectCreationHeader
virtual ~FNetObjectCreationHeader ()
 
void SetProtocolId (uint32 InId)
 
void SetFactoryId (FNetObjectFactoryId InId)
 
FReplicationProtocolIdentifier GetProtocolId () const
 
FNetObjectFactoryId GetNetFactoryId () const
 

Public Attributes

FNetObjectReference ObjectReference
 
- Public Attributes inherited from UE::Net::FBaseActorNetCreationHeader
TArray< uint8CustomCreationData
 
uint16 CustomCreationDataBitCount = 0
 

Detailed Description

Header information representing static actors

Member Function Documentation

◆ Deserialize()

bool UE::Net::FStaticActorNetCreationHeader::Deserialize ( const FCreationHeaderContext Context)
overridevirtual

◆ IsDynamic()

virtual bool UE::Net::FStaticActorNetCreationHeader::IsDynamic ( ) const
inlinevirtual

Is the header representing a dynamic or stable actor

Implements UE::Net::FBaseActorNetCreationHeader.

◆ IsPreregistered()

virtual bool UE::Net::FStaticActorNetCreationHeader::IsPreregistered ( ) const
inlinevirtual

Is the header representing a dynamic pre-registered actor

Implements UE::Net::FBaseActorNetCreationHeader.

◆ Serialize()

bool UE::Net::FStaticActorNetCreationHeader::Serialize ( const FCreationHeaderContext Context) const
overridevirtual

◆ ToString()

FString UE::Net::FStaticActorNetCreationHeader::ToString ( ) const
overridevirtual

Transform the header information into a readable format

Reimplemented from UE::Net::FNetObjectCreationHeader.

Member Data Documentation

◆ ObjectReference

FNetObjectReference UE::Net::FStaticActorNetCreationHeader::ObjectReference

The documentation for this class was generated from the following files: